Build provenance — Orders soft deletes. The Cartographer service marks rows with a deleted_at timestamp rather than removing them; the nightly reaper purges rows older than 90 days. Last week's migration added a partial index so list queries skip tombstones. For the eng sync: provenance attestation for the migration build is verified and recorded. The attested build is referenced by the token below.

pipeline stamp: htk31_f769b577b3028a4e9958e5bb8d1259a

Subject: Checkout cut-over done — quick recap

Hey, cut-over for the Brindlecart checkout flow wrapped at 02:10. Load tests held at 3x normal traffic, p99 stayed under 400ms, zero dropped carts. Payment retries are now handled by Quillpay's new adapter. If anything pages tonight, restart the worker pool first. The live config we shipped with is below.

deployment values, faduf-tawep:
SORDOR_LOG_LEVEL=error
SORDOR_METRICS_HOST=metrics.sordor.nelvrolabs.internal
SORDOR_POOL_SIZE=4

Welcome to the Quillpress review rotation. Quillpress renders PDF invoices for Torvane Billing, and most diffs touch the layout engine in render/core. When reviewing, check that font embedding stays deterministic and that golden-file tests regenerate cleanly. The signing keystore for release builds lives in the team vault; reviewers occasionally need it to verify artifact signatures locally. Access is gated by the vault's recovery flow, which Marla on the platform team set up last quarter. The recovery passphrase is:

recovery phrase for bawip-tawip: wenix-praion